Benefits of Chromecast Integration

Chromecast integration offers a myriad of benefits for users of TCL TVs, enhancing the overall streaming experience and providing seamless access to a wide array of content. Here are some compelling advantages of incorporating Chromecast with TCL TVs:

  • Effortless Streaming: With Chromecast integration, users can effortlessly stream their favorite movies, TV shows, music, and more directly to their TCL TVs from their smartphones, tablets, or laptops. This seamless connectivity eliminates the need for cumbersome cables and allows for a more convenient and enjoyable streaming experience.

  • Expanded Content Options: By leveraging Chromecast, TCL TV owners gain access to a diverse range of streaming services and apps, expanding their entertainment options. Whether it's popular video streaming platforms, music apps, or even web browsers, Chromecast integration opens up a world of content at the users' fingertips.

  • High-Quality Viewing Experience: Chromecast integration enables users to enjoy high-quality, high-definition content on their TCL TVs. Whether it's streaming the latest blockbuster movie or viewing stunning visual content, the integration ensures that the viewing experience is immersive and visually captivating.

  • Multi-Device Compatibility: Chromecast integration allows for seamless connectivity across multiple devices, enabling users to cast content from various compatible devices to their TCL TVs. This flexibility ensures that users can easily switch between devices and continue enjoying their favorite content without interruption.

  • User-Friendly Interface: With Chromecast, users can navigate and control their streaming experience with ease. The intuitive interface and user-friendly controls make it simple to cast content, adjust settings, and explore different streaming options, enhancing the overall user experience.

  • Enhanced Convenience: By integrating Chromecast with TCL TVs, users can enjoy the convenience of controlling their viewing experience from their preferred devices. Whether it's using a smartphone, tablet, or laptop, the seamless integration offers unparalleled convenience and flexibility.

In summary, the integration of Chromecast with TCL TVs brings forth a host of benefits, including effortless streaming, expanded content options, high-quality viewing experiences, multi-device compatibility, a user-friendly interface, and enhanced convenience. This integration elevates the overall streaming experience, providing users with a seamless and immersive way to access and enjoy their favorite content on TCL TVs.

 

How to Set Up Chromecast with TCL TVs

Setting up Chromecast with TCL TVs is a straightforward process that enables users to seamlessly stream content from their mobile devices or computers to their television screens. Follow these simple steps to set up Chromecast with your TCL TV and begin enjoying a diverse range of streaming options:

  1. Connect the Chromecast Device: Start by plugging the Chromecast device into an available HDMI port on your TCL TV. Ensure that the Chromecast device is securely connected and powered on.

  2. Access the Input Source: Using your TCL TV remote, navigate to the input source that corresponds to the HDMI port into which the Chromecast device is connected. This allows the TV to recognize the Chromecast device and prepare for the setup process.

  3. Download the Google Home App: To proceed with the setup, download the Google Home app on your smartphone or tablet from the App Store or Google Play Store. This app will serve as the primary interface for configuring the Chromecast device.

  4. Follow the Setup Instructions: Open the Google Home app and follow the on-screen instructions to set up the Chromecast device. This typically involves connecting the device to your Wi-Fi network and ensuring that it is linked to the same network as your mobile device or computer.

  5. Name Your Chromecast: During the setup process, you will have the option to give your Chromecast device a unique name. This can be helpful if you have multiple Chromecast devices in different rooms, allowing you to easily identify and select the desired device for streaming.

  6. Start Casting: Once the setup is complete, you can start casting content to your TCL TV. Simply open a supported app on your mobile device or computer, look for the cast icon, and select your Chromecast device from the list of available devices. Your chosen content will then begin streaming on the TV screen.

  7. Explore Additional Features: Take advantage of additional features offered by Chromecast, such as mirroring your device's screen to the TV or using voice commands to control playback. These features can further enhance your streaming experience and provide added convenience.

By following these steps, you can seamlessly set up Chromecast with your TCL TV, unlocking a world of entertainment options and enjoying the flexibility of streaming content from your favorite devices to the big screen. Whether it's streaming movies, TV shows, music, or online videos, Chromecast integration with TCL TVs offers a user-friendly and versatile streaming solution.

 

Compatible Apps for Seamless Streaming

When it comes to leveraging Chromecast integration with TCL TVs, users gain access to a diverse array of compatible apps that facilitate seamless streaming of their favorite content. These apps are designed to offer a user-friendly and immersive streaming experience, allowing users to cast a wide range of media directly to their TCL TVs. Whether it's popular video streaming services, music platforms, or even web browsers, the compatibility of these apps with Chromecast ensures that users can effortlessly access and enjoy their preferred content on the big screen.

One of the standout compatible apps for seamless streaming is YouTube. As a leading video-sharing platform, YouTube allows users to discover and stream an extensive collection of videos, including music videos, vlogs, tutorials, and more. With Chromecast integration, users can easily cast YouTube content from their mobile devices or computers to their TCL TVs, enabling a more engaging and immersive viewing experience.

Additionally, Netflix stands out as a prominent streaming service that seamlessly integrates with Chromecast and TCL TVs. With a vast library of movies, TV shows, documentaries, and original content, Netflix offers users the ability to cast their preferred content directly to their television screens. This compatibility enhances the convenience and accessibility of Netflix, allowing users to enjoy high-quality streaming on their TCL TVs.

Furthermore, music enthusiasts can take advantage of Spotify's compatibility with Chromecast and TCL TVs. Spotify, a popular music streaming platform, enables users to cast their favorite songs, playlists, and podcasts to their television speakers, creating a dynamic audio experience. Whether it's hosting a music listening session or setting the mood for a gathering, Spotify's seamless integration with Chromecast enhances the overall music streaming experience.

In addition to video and music streaming, the compatibility of web browsers such as Google Chrome with Chromecast and TCL TVs offers users the flexibility to cast web-based content to their television screens. This feature is particularly useful for sharing online videos, accessing web-based presentations, or simply browsing the internet on a larger display, enhancing the versatility of the streaming experience.

Other notable compatible apps for seamless streaming include Hulu, Disney+, HBO Max, Amazon Prime Video, and more. These apps cater to a wide range of entertainment preferences, ensuring that users can effortlessly cast their desired content to their TCL TVs for an immersive and personalized viewing experience.

In summary, the compatibility of leading apps with Chromecast and TCL TVs provides users with a diverse selection of streaming options, ranging from video and music services to web-based content. This seamless integration enhances the accessibility and convenience of streaming, allowing users to enjoy their preferred content on the big screen with ease.

 

Troubleshooting Common Issues with Chromecast Integration

While Chromecast integration with TCL TVs offers a seamless streaming experience, users may encounter common issues that can impact the functionality of the setup. Understanding these issues and knowing how to troubleshoot them can help ensure a smooth and uninterrupted streaming experience. Here are some common issues and troubleshooting steps to address them:

1. Connectivity Problems:

  • Issue: Users may experience difficulty connecting their mobile devices or computers to the Chromecast device.
  • Troubleshooting: Ensure that the mobile device or computer is connected to the same Wi-Fi network as the Chromecast device. Restarting the Wi-Fi router and the Chromecast device can also help resolve connectivity issues.

2. Audio or Video Playback Issues:

  • Issue: Users may encounter issues with audio or video playback, such as audio lag, stuttering, or poor video quality.
  • Troubleshooting: Check the internet connection speed to ensure it meets the recommended bandwidth for streaming. Closing background apps on the casting device and ensuring that the Chromecast device is placed within a reasonable range of the Wi-Fi router can help improve playback quality.

3. Device Recognition Problems:

  • Issue: The TCL TV may fail to recognize the connected Chromecast device, preventing seamless casting.
  • Troubleshooting: Restart the TCL TV and the Chromecast device to refresh the connection. Additionally, ensuring that the HDMI port used for the Chromecast device is functioning properly can help resolve recognition issues.

4. Firmware and App Updates:

  • Issue: Outdated firmware on the TCL TV or outdated versions of streaming apps may lead to compatibility issues with Chromecast.
  • Troubleshooting: Regularly check for firmware updates for the TCL TV and ensure that streaming apps are updated to the latest versions. This can address potential compatibility issues and improve overall performance.

5. Power Supply and Overheating:

  • Issue: Overheating of the Chromecast device or inadequate power supply can lead to performance issues.
  • Troubleshooting: Ensure that the Chromecast device is adequately ventilated and not placed in direct sunlight or near heat sources. Using the provided power adapter and avoiding the use of third-party adapters can help maintain stable power supply to the device.

By being aware of these common issues and implementing the corresponding troubleshooting steps, users can effectively address potential challenges related to Chromecast integration with TCL TVs. This proactive approach can help optimize the streaming experience and ensure consistent performance when casting content to the television screen.
